Uncertainty surrounds Stefan Keller's future at Al-Ittihad following AFC Champions League exit
Cameroonian defender Stefan Keller, currently on loan from AEL Limassol, faces an uncertain future at Saudi club Al-Ittihad. The team, managed by Sergio Conceicao, was recently eliminated from the Asian Champions League by Japanese club Machida Zelvia, an outcome viewed as a significant failure for the organization. Reports regarding Keller's status are conflicting following the club's early exit from the competition. While some Saudi media sources suggest that the loan agreement has officially terminated and that the club will not exercise its purchase option, others indicate that a final decision regarding the purchase has been postponed until the end of the season. The club administration is currently reviewing the team's roster as a direct consequence of the recent performance slump. AEL Limassol is awaiting formal communication from Al-Ittihad to clarify the status of the player's contractual obligations. The final determination on whether the transfer becomes permanent or expires remains pending official confirmation from the Saudi club's management.
